
拓海先生、最近部下から「検証器を評価するベンチマークが重要だ」と聞きました。正直、何の話か見当がつかないのですが、要点を教えていただけますか。

素晴らしい着眼点ですね!簡単に言うと、最近の大規模言語モデル(LLM: Large Language Model)大規模言語モデルは、自分の出力が正しいかどうかを確かめる「検証器」を使って学ぶことが増えているのです。VerifyBenchはその検証器を公平に比べるためのテストセットで、検証の精度や頑健性を定量化できるようにするものですよ。

検証器というのは要するに、AIが出した答えを「合っている/間違っている」で判定する人みたいなものですか。これって要するに検証基準を統一するということ?

正確です。大丈夫、一緒に整理しましょう。ポイントは三つです。まず、検証器にはルールベース型とモデルベース型があって、それぞれ得意と不得意が異なる。次に、出力の長さや表現の多様性で判定性能が大きく変わる。最後に、これらを横断的に比べる基準がなかったため、開発や運用に迷いが生じていたのです。

なるほど。実務で言うと、うちの現場がAIの判断を信用して工程を自動化したい場合、どの検証器を使えばいいか迷うということですね。投資対効果の観点での指標も欲しい。

その懸念は的を射ていますよ。VerifyBenchは約4,000問の専門領域(数学、物理、化学、生物)から成るベンチで、専門家が付けた正解とさまざまなモデルの応答を揃えているため、精度(precision)と再現率(recall)のトレードオフや、長文応答に対する頑健性を比較できるのです。これにより、現場に合った検証器の選び方の指針が得られます。

それはありがたい。具体的には、専門化した小さなモデルと、汎用の大きなモデルのどちらが優れているのですか。コストの面も知りたいです。

良い視点です。専門化した検証器は特化した表現に強く、精度は高いが新しい書き方に弱い。一方で、汎用LLMは表現の幅に強く柔軟だが、一貫性や精密さに欠けることがある。実務ではまず目的を明確にし、誤判定が許されない箇所は専門化検証器、表現の自由度が重要な場面は汎用検証器と併用する運用が現実的です。

なるほど、両方の長所を活かすのが肝か。導入の順序や評価の仕方は教えてもらえますか。現場に負担をかけたくないのです。

順序としては、小さな検証実験で運用負荷と誤判定コストを測ることから始めましょう。VerifyBenchは短い出力と長い出力、抜粋された答えと全文という条件を組み合わせた評価を提供しているため、実際の運用に近いケースで検証器を試すことができます。要点は三つ、現場に近い条件で評価する、誤判定コストを定量にする、段階的に自動化する、です。

これって要するに私たちが現場でAIを信用して一部工程を任せるために、どの検証器をどう使うかを決めるためのルールブックになる、という理解でいいですか。

その通りです。大丈夫、難しく聞こえる部分は私が一緒に現場に落とし込みますよ。VerifyBenchは評価の基準とテスト例を提供することで、検証器を選ぶときの「ものさし」になってくれます。つまり、確かなデータに基づいて投資判断ができるようになるのです。

分かりました。最後に私の言葉で整理しますと、VerifyBenchは多領域にわたる標準検査セットを用意して、専門特化型と汎用型の検証器の長短を定量的に比較できるようにするもので、それにより現場の自動化投資の判断材料が得られる、ということですね。


